Here in Plain Sight.Very little stirs in the shallows at the lake's edge. A fish grows incautious in the heat of a summer afternoon. Slowly it drifts from under a sheltering lily pad, and ... SPLASH! GULP! Lunch for the stately, stealthy great blue heron. The great blue heron can turn invisible. Well, not really. But it stands so still that the frogs, snakes, and fish it eats don't see it--until it's too late. Not bad for a four-foot-tall bird with blue feathers and a big, pointy, dangerous-looking beak. |
